About 4 Cecil Lodge
4 Cecil Lodge is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Chessington (KT9 1PD). It has a recorded floor area of 116 m² (around 1249 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band C. Tenure is freehold. At 116 m² this is the largest unit on EPC record across the building (77–116 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. Other recorded features include a balcony. The latest certificate (October 2018) shows a C (score 73). When first surveyed in February 2012 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and window efficiency went from Average to Good.
Last sale on file: £326,000 in September 2019.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 116 m² it's 28.9% larger than the typical home in the postcode (90 m² median across 13 EPCs). Across 2000–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£373,000 is 14.4%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£261/sq ft) was about 32.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
